Where is Farthingloe Farm?
Where is Farthingloe Farm located?
Farthingloe Farm, Farthingloe Farm, Great Britain (approx. 51.117428°, 1.277894°)
Where is Farthingloe Farm on the map?
{"latitude":51.117428,"longitude":1.277894,"title":"Farthingloe Farm"}